Description
Mason Twill fabric is a durable and comfortable fabric with a soft, diagonally ribbed texture. Woven in a tight twill style weave that has a slight shine, Mason Twill fabric is a firm fabric made from 100% hypoallergenic cotton fibers. Mason Twill fabric weighs approximately 14 oz per linear yard, has a 268 GSM, is 0.5 mm thick, and measures 58/60 inches wide. When hung, Mason Twill fabric has a relaxed drape and holds its shape. Check out our un-dyed, natural (PFD) Mason Twill fabric. PFD, or prepared for dyeing fabric has no whiteners added and is ready to be dyed any color.
Mason Twill fabric is a comfortable and stylish fabric that can be used for a variety of apparel or decors. Durable and shape forming, use Mason Twill fabric to craft chino or khaki pants, uniforms, button-down shirts, and SEW much more! Additionally, Mason Twill fabric can be used to create decors such as table covers, curtains, and upholstery.
